Buying Guide

  • Probe length and depth: Longer probes reach deeper root zones, which is essential for large pots, raised beds, and garden plots. Choose a length that matches your containers and soil depth.
  • Reading method: Analog dials are quick and battery-free, while digital or LCD displays can consolidate multiple metrics in one glance. Consider your preferred workflow and whether you need single-parameter or multi-parameter data.
  • Calibration and soil type: Some meters require calibration, and readings can vary with soil composition (sand, clay, loam). Look for models with clear calibration notes and guidance.
  • Durability and materials: Stainless steel probes resist corrosion, while plastic housings reduce weight for frequent use. For outdoor use, weather resistance and build quality matter.
  • Maintenance: Prevent corrosion by limiting prolonged soil exposure to the metal tip. Some meters feature replaceable probes—useful for extending the tool’s lifespan.
  • Power and convenience: Battery-free options offer simplicity and reliability, especially in garden settings without access to electricity. Multi-parameter meters can replace several tools but may require more setup.
  • Use case alignment: For indoor plants, compact meters with easy readability may suffice. For outdoor beds and farming, longer probes and rugged construction are typically preferred.
